Base metals firmer despite China lowering its growth target

March 05, 2019 / www.metalbulletinresearch.com

Three-month base metals prices on the London Metal Exchange were up across the board by an average of 0.8% this morning, Tuesday March 5. Volume was well above average with 12,645 lots having changed hands on Select as at 06.30am London time, compared with 6,685 lots at a similar time on Monday. Metals consolidate as poor Chinese PMI data weighs on sentiment

February 28, 2019 / www.metalbulletinresearch.com

A drop in China’s manufacturing purchasing managers’ index (PMI) to 49.2 in February, from 49.5 in January, has set a weaker tone across markets with base metals traded on the London Metal Exchange mostly lower and down by an average of 0.3% in the morning of Thursday February 28.
